When Something's Wrong, You Shouldn't Need SSH

A crashed service. A broken nginx config after a manual edit. A disk quietly filling up with old logs. A home directory with the wrong file ownership after someone ran a command as the wrong user. These are the everyday problems that eat up an admin's time — usually solved by SSHing in, running a handful of commands, and hoping nothing else breaks along the way.

Panelica's Repair Tool turns that troubleshooting session into a dashboard: it scans the server, tells you what is wrong, and fixes it with one click.

What It Does

Health Dashboard

The Repair Tool runs a set of checks against the server and reports each one as OK, Warning, or Critical — covering services, sockets, disk space, and file ownership.

Preview Before You Apply

Every fix can be previewed first, so you see exactly what it is going to do before anything changes. Fixes marked as destructive require an extra confirmation step.

What It Can Fix

  • Service restart — restarts a stopped or misbehaving service, with an idempotent check so it will not restart something that is already healthy.
  • Config regenerate — rebuilds a domain's nginx configuration, backing up the previous config and validating the new one before applying it. If the new config does not pass validation, it rolls back automatically instead of taking the site down.
  • Disk cleanup — clears temporary files, cache, trash, and rotated log files. It never touches databases, backups, or quarantined files.
  • File ownership repair — fixes a home directory or domain's file ownership without breaking the directories the web server needs to write to, such as logs and session storage.

Per-User Permission Table

Alongside the general checks, the Repair Tool lists every user account with its home directory ownership status, and gives you a one-click fix for that specific user — without touching every other account on the server.

Always-On Maintenance

A "Free up disk space" action is always available in the Maintenance section, independent of whether the health scan currently flags disk space as a problem.

How to Use It

  1. Log in to your Panelica panel with a ROOT account.
  2. Open Tools and select Repair.
  3. Review the health dashboard — see how many checks are OK, how many need attention, and how many are critical.
  4. Click into a warning or critical item to preview exactly what the suggested fix will do.
  5. Apply the fix. Destructive actions ask for confirmation first.
  6. The affected check re-scans automatically so you see the updated status right away.
  7. For ownership issues on a specific account, use the per-user permission table to fix that one user without touching the rest.

Frequently Asked Questions

Can the Repair Tool break my site's configuration?

Config changes are backed up first and validated before being applied; if validation fails, Panelica rolls back automatically.

Will disk cleanup delete my backups?

No. Disk cleanup only removes temporary files, cache, trash, and rotated logs — it never touches databases, backups, or quarantined files.

Who can access the Repair Tool?

It is available to ROOT-level accounts.
